Transaction 251ff421a90519d181dcf47c0d4b00ae77912c780efac496293be973da4c96d6
1 Input
1 Output
-
251ff421a90519d181dcf47c0d4b00ae77912c780efac496293be973da4c96d6:0
- value
- 541923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d21c2155461bb53aaa70d89e832310c6309e8d4 OP_EQUAL
- address
- 3LPetRdkpy9xRphY5MhGHB7Vy9anjiborZ